Black Entrepreneurship Program
The Black Entrepreneurship Program (BEP) is a partnership between the Government of Canada, Black-led business organizations, and financial institutions. With an investment of up to $221 million over four years.

Community Forward Fund
Community Forward Fund provides loans to non-profits, charities and non-profit social enterprises. The organization lends to entrepreneurs / organizations that are committed to making a difference in their communities. Financing is flexible and designed to meet your organization’s needs.

Community Support, Multiculturalism, and Anti-Racism Initiatives Program (National)
The Projects component of the Community Support, Multiculturalism, and Anti-Racism Initiatives Program provides funding for community development, anti-racism initiatives, and engagement projects that promote diversity and inclusion by encouraging interaction among community groups.

Canadian Environmental Assessment Agency - Participant Funding Program (National)
Provides funding to individuals and nonprofit organizations interested in participating in environmental assessments

Rise Up Pitch
Rise up is now more than a pitch competition. The BBPA evolved it into a full entrepreneurial program for Black women called RiseUp Women+.
The third annual RiseUp Pitch Competition and Program offers the opportunity for Black Women entrepreneurs at different stages of business to pitch for the chance to win $10,000 and access to entrepreneurial development resources.
